Synopsis

Expose of Freemasonry: a sharp, accessible critique grounded in the author’s experience. This thorough examination argues that modern Freemasonry mirrors ancient worship practices, using clear evidence drawn from Masonry’s own history and symbols to question its religious claims.

This edition presents a straightforward, readable look at the origins of speculative Masonry, its spread across Europe, and the connections some readers fear between the Masonic system and pagan rites. It aims to shed light for anyone curious about what lies behind lodge rituals and moral vows, without sensationalism.


  • How the author traces Masonry’s rise from operative craft groups to a worldwide fraternity.

  • Illustrations and descriptions of lodge life, ceremonies, and emblems to help readers understand what the Order teaches.

  • Arguments comparing Masonic practice with ancient mysteries and Christian perspectives.

  • Discussion of personal vocation and the author’s call for critical examination by believers and nonbelievers alike.



Ideal for readers of religious history, amateur historians, or anyone seeking a clear, critical view of Freemasonry and its claims. This edition invites thoughtful consideration of how a long-running tradition shapes beliefs and loyalties.
